Vimala Raman in Apoorva
Bharatanatyam dancer-turned-actress Vimala Raman, who was lucky enough to get a handful of offers from some big banners and directors even before the release of her first movie in Malayalam, Time, directed by Shaji Kailas, is to do the key role in Apoorva to be directed by debutante Nithin Ramakrishnan.
Vimala, who won the Miss India Australia 2004 title and the Miss India Australia Cyber Queen title, is the only actress in Malayalam who has acted with almost all biggies in the industry in the beginning of her career itself (Time with Suresh Gopi, Nasrani with Mammootty, Romeo and Calcutta News with Dileep and College Kumaran with Mohanlal). Her plus point is that she has an unique blend of young looks and mature behaviour, which make her he right choice to act with the seniors and newcomers alike.
Produced by Dr. Samson and Dr. Ramakrishnan under the banner of Gauri Creations, Apoorva features story and script by Nithin himself. The story is about adolescence, relationships and friendships of school life. The film is made on a one crore budget. Music is by Vidhyadharan Master and camera has been handled by Jithu.
The cast includes Kalabhavan Mani, Jagathy Sreekumar, Tamil actor Senthil, Sanjeev, Helen, Kalpana, Ajay Sathyan, Anirudh Rajasekhar, Nithish, Preethi, Baby Minu, Master Ananthu, etc.

Prithviraj in Nagercoil
After the commendable performances in Mozhi, Kana Kandein, Satthum Podaathey, Kannaamoochi Enadaa and Vellitherai, Prithviraj has carved a place for himself in Kollywood and has a lot of offers coming his way. Sources say that the actor is to play an interesting character, one that he has not played so far in Nagercoil to be produced by P. Arumugam.
Nagercoil is about a well-educated rationalist who works as a software engineer. Being a man who loves his urban and modern culture, he is in conflict with his family. He does not believe in the archaic school of thoughts which have made his family rich and famous. He is scared that his family might force him to take up the ancestral profession.
In the course of time, he falls in love and marries a girl (Padmapriya), who is as rational as he is. What happens when she enters his family is what the story focuses on. Sources said that the film portrays this sensitive subject in a beautiful manner. Prithviraj and Padmapriya have acted together earlier in Satthum Podaathey. The film is directed by Surendar and produced under the banner of Tiruppur M.P.S. Theatre. Dialogues are by E.M.S. Raja and songs by Samson.

Mohini getting divorced
It seems to be the season of divorces. Following two famous South Indian actors, Prakashraj and Urvashi, who sought divorces recently, now it is the turn of Mohini, the yesteryear actress who had acted in many films in all the four South Indian languages, especially Nadodi, Parinayam, Ghazal and Pattabhishekam in Malayalam.
Mohini, who debuted in Tamil with Keyar’s Eeramana Rojavae in the early nineties, married Bharath, with whom she was in love, around four years ago; they have a 2-year old son.
Serious difference of opinion between them have forced Mohini to live separately and she was living with her parents. Now the couple mutually agreed to separate and have filed for divorce.
The case came up for hearing on 13th June in the Family Court. The estranged couple was present on the occasion. Justice Narayanasamy posted the next hearing to 15th December.
